In the Islamic Economic System, Waqaf is one of the instruments of Islamic Economics. Waqaf has long been practiced among the people of Bireuen Regency so that the potential of waqaf is spread in villages, cities and provinces in Indonesia. This study aims to look at the practice of waqaf models in Bireuen District. The sample in this study is the Waqaf manager at the Office of the Ministry of Religion of the Republic of Indonesia. Data sources were obtained from primary and secondary sources. The data analysis used is descriptive qualitative. From the results of the study it was found that there were two waqaf practice models in Bireuen District, namely the model of al-ijarah and al-Mukhabarah. The two models have a contribution to the welfare of recipients of waqf assets and also influence the financing of waqf consumptive models.
